Tokyo Shiodome Building Installs Bloom Energy Server

June 17, 2014
SoftBank Group
Bloom Energy Japan Limited

The SoftBank Group (Tokyo, Japan, Representative Director: Masayoshi Son) and Bloom Energy Japan Limited (Tokyo, Japan, Representative Director and CEO: Shigeki Miwa, hereafter “Bloom Energy Japan”)  today announced the installation of the “Bloom Energy Server,” an innovative and clean electricity generation system, at Tokyo Shiodome Building on June 17 in Minato Ku, Tokyo Prefecture. The Bloom Energy Server installed at Tokyo Shiodome Building, home to SoftBank Group headquarters, can produce 200 kilowatts of power and provides 14% of the buildings’ overall electricity needs.

The Bloom Energy Server is a breakthrough solid oxide fuel cell technology that generates clean electricity from multiple fuel sources such as city gas and biogas at over 60% efficiency*. Bloom Energy Servers have been installed in many locations that require uninterrupted power supply such as data centers, manufacturing operations, communications, and facilities with high energy loads including refrigeration and critical services in the U.S.A.
*Initial performance.

To contribute to disaster preparedness in Tokyo, Bloom Energy Japan can supply electricity generated by Bloom Energy Servers to streetlights and free power outlets in emergencies. Furthermore, to contribute to the clean energy urban development of Tokyo, Bloom Energy Japan is also supplying electricity for EV stands installed on the underground parking floor of Tokyo Shiodome Building.

About Bloom Energy Server at Tokyo Shiodome Building:
Location 1-9-1 Higashi Shimbashi, Minato Ku, Tokyo, Japan
Area 60m² (approx.)*1
Power Capacity 200kW (approx.)
Rated Electric Efficiency 60%+ *2
Size(Width x Height x depth)/Weight 9.1m x 2.1m x 2.6m / 19.9t (approx.)
Date of operation June 17, 2014(Tuesday)

*1 Including maintenance space.
*2 Initial performance.

慶應義塾大学湘南藤沢キャンパス(SFC)で燃料電池発電システムを導入
「Bloomエナジーサーバー」の運転を開始

2014/06/17  

慶應義塾大学
Bloom Energy Japan株式会社

慶應義塾大学(所在地:東京都港区、塾長:清家篤)とソフトバンクグループで発電事業を行うBloom Energy Japan株式会社(ブルームエナジージャパン、所在地:東京都港区、代表取締役社長:三輪茂基、以下「BloomEnergy Japan」)は、クリーンで高効率な業務用・産業用燃料電池発電システム「Bloomエナジーサーバー」を慶應義塾大学湘南藤沢キャンパスΔ館(以下「デルタ館」)に設置し、2014年6月17日より営業運転を開始します。今回導入する「Bloomエナジーサーバー」の出力規模は200kWで、1年を通してデルタ館および隣接の大学院棟τ館(以下「タウ館」)の電力需要の90%以上を賄うことができます。
